Arsenal were made to weather the Selhurst Park storm but eventually got over the line on Monday night with a 1-0 win against Crystal Palace.
Martin Odegaard’s penalty gave the Gunners the lead before Takehiro Tomiyasu was dismissed for two yellow cards picked up in quick succession, leaving Mikel Arteta’s side to hold firm at the back until the full-time whistle finally blew.
